Coût de développement d'une application mobile en 2026 : méthodes, outils et budgets

6 min de lecture
Coût de développement d'une application mobile en 2026 : méthodes, outils et budgets

Méthodes de développement : natif, hybride ou low-code ?

Le choix de la méthode détermine les performances, le coût et le temps de développement. Trois approches dominent le marché en 2026 : le développement natif, l’hybride et le low-code, chacune répondant à des besoins spécifiques.

Le développement natif consiste à créer une application spécifiquement pour une plateforme : Swift ou Objective-C pour iOS, Kotlin ou Java pour Android. Cette méthode offre les meilleures performances et une expérience utilisateur optimale, mais nécessite des équipes spécialisées et un budget plus élevé. Elle garantit une fluidité inégalée, un accès complet aux fonctionnalités du système (caméra, GPS, notifications) et une cohérence parfaite avec les guidelines des plateformes. Cependant, elle implique des coûts élevés, des délais plus longs et une maintenance complexe. En 2026, elle reste indispensable pour les applications exigeantes comme les jeux mobiles ou les outils professionnels nécessitant une intégration matérielle poussée.

Le développement hybride utilise des frameworks comme Flutter ou React Native pour créer une application compatible avec iOS et Android. Ces outils mutualisent jusqu’à 90 % du code, réduisant coûts et délais de 30 à 40 %. La qualité est proche du natif pour la plupart des projets, et la maintenance est simplifiée. Toutefois, les performances peuvent être légèrement inférieures pour les applications très complexes, et l’accès à certaines fonctionnalités avancées reste limité. Flutter, avec son langage Dart, est apprécié pour sa rapidité et ses widgets personnalisables, tandis que React Native, basé sur JavaScript, bénéficie d’une large communauté.

Les plateformes low-code comme Glide, Adalo ou Bubble permettent de créer des applications avec peu ou pas de code, idéales pour les prototypes ou les MVP. Elles offrent une rapidité exceptionnelle (quelques semaines pour un MVP) et des coûts réduits, mais leurs fonctionnalités sont restreintes, et les performances inférieures aux autres méthodes. En 2026, elles conviennent aux startups et PME souhaitant tester une idée rapidement, mais montrent leurs limites pour des projets ambitieux.

Outils de développement : Flutter, React Native, Swift et plus

Le choix des outils dépend de la méthode retenue et des compétences de votre équipe.

Flutter, développé par Google, est un framework open-source permettant de créer des applications mobiles, web et desktop à partir d’un seul code source. Il utilise Dart et offre une bibliothèque de widgets personnalisables. Ses performances sont proches du natif, et son “hot reload” accélère le développement. Compatible avec iOS, Android, le web et le desktop, il est idéal pour les startups, les MVP et les interfaces riches. En 2026, il est utilisé par plus de 2 millions de développeurs, dont Google Ads, Alibaba ou eBay.

React Native, développé par Facebook, permet de créer des applications mobiles en JavaScript et React. Il bénéficie d’une large communauté et d’une intégration facile avec les bibliothèques JavaScript. Ses performances sont proches du natif pour la plupart des projets, et il est compatible avec iOS et Android. Il convient aux applications d’entreprises, aux projets intégrant des outils web existants et aux interfaces front-end. Des entreprises comme Facebook, Instagram ou Shopify l’utilisent.

Pour le développement natif, Swift (iOS) et Kotlin (Android) sont les langages de référence. Swift, développé par Apple, est moderne et performant, avec une syntaxe claire. Il est utilisé par LinkedIn, Airbnb ou Uber. Kotlin, soutenu par Google, est le langage officiel pour Android. Il offre une interopérabilité avec Java et une syntaxe concise, utilisé par Trello, Netflix ou Pinterest.

Budget : combien coûte le développement d’une application mobile en 2026 ?

Le budget dépend de la complexité, de la méthode et de la localisation de l’équipe.

ComplexitéFonctionnalitésMéthode recommandéeCoût estimé (€)Délai estimé
SimpleInterface basique, pas de backend, fonctionnalités limitées.Low-code ou hybride20 000 - 50 0002 à 4 mois
MoyenneInterface personnalisée, backend simple, intégrations API.Hybride50 000 - 100 0004 à 6 mois
ComplexeInterface avancée, backend complexe, intégrations multiples, performances élevées.Natif ou hybride100 000 - 150 000+6 à 12 mois

Le budget se répartit généralement ainsi : 60 % pour le développement (conception, codage, tests), 15 % pour le design (UI/UX), 15 % pour le backend (serveur, base de données, API) et 10 % pour la gestion de projet.

Pour optimiser les coûts, commencez par un MVP pour valider votre idée, utilisez des outils hybrides comme Flutter ou React Native, externalisez certaines tâches (design, backend) et priorisez les fonctionnalités essentielles.

Étapes clés pour développer une application mobile en 2026

Développer une application mobile nécessite une planification rigoureuse.

Avant de commencer, définissez les objectifs et le public cible. Clarifiez le problème résolu par votre application, identifiez vos utilisateurs et leurs besoins, et fixez un budget et un calendrier. Une étude de marché et une analyse concurrentielle sont indispensables pour valider votre idée.

L’UX et l’UI sont cruciaux pour le succès de votre application. Créez des personas et des parcours utilisateurs pour identifier les points de friction. Réalisez des wireframes et des maquettes interactives pour tester l’ergonomie. Choisissez une palette de couleurs et des typographies adaptées à votre marque.

En fonction de vos objectifs et de votre budget, choisissez la méthode (natif, hybride ou low-code) et les outils adaptés. Pour plus de détails, consultez notre guide sur comment créer des applications mobiles en 2026.

Le développement inclut la création du front-end, du back-end, l’intégration des deux et les tests. Ces derniers sont essentiels : tests unitaires, d’intégration et utilisateurs pour garantir la qualité. Une fois l’application testée, déployez-la sur les stores (App Store, Google Play) avec une fiche optimisée (description, captures d’écran, vidéo). Utilisez l’ASO pour améliorer la visibilité et élaborez une stratégie de lancement (réseaux sociaux, relations presse, publicité). Une stratégie de marketing digital est indispensable pour attirer des utilisateurs.

Après le lancement, prévoyez des mises à jour régulières pour corriger les bugs et améliorer les fonctionnalités. Assurez un support utilisateur réactif et analysez les données (taux de rétention, temps passé) pour ajouter de nouvelles fonctionnalités.

Prochaine étape : lancez votre projet

Développer une application mobile en 2026 nécessite une planification rigoureuse et le choix des bonnes méthodes. Que vous optiez pour du natif, de l’hybride ou du low-code, définissez clairement vos objectifs, votre public et votre budget.

Commencez par un MVP pour tester votre idée, utilisez des outils comme Flutter ou React Native pour réduire coûts et délais, et prévoyez une stratégie de marketing digital pour promouvoir votre application.

Pour aller plus loin, explorez les tendances du marché des applications mobiles en 2026 et découvrez comment investir dans les secteurs tech porteurs.